Product Description Escaping from his would-be killers after he is falsely condemned and banished from England, Gray de Valance sets out to prove his innocence and finds his hopes threatened by the beautiful Juliana Welles.

    awesome, 2000-04-09 After reading most of her works, I am thoroughly convinced that Ms. Robinson cannot write a bad book if she tried. Julianna Welles, the heroine in this book, is strongwilled, intelligent, and sassy. Julianna's heated interactions with the virile Gray de Valence made me wish the book was twice as long. Ms. Robinson's subplots are well developed and her minor characters are just as interesting as the main ones. Lord of the Dragon was a delight to read, and I am currently searching amazon.com for Suzanne Robinson's other works to see what I am missing.
